This role will be accountable for the successful execution of a portfolio of major subcontracts in; Complex Platform Systems , Platform Integration, Special Projects and Weapons areas & domains to meet domestic and international programme and business needs. LMUK(Ampthill) has a worldwide supply base although predominantly in the UK, Europe, Middle East and the US.
Opportunities also exist to develop comprehensive supply chain strategies and solutions to support bids, proposals within the Defence Sector and commercial environments as business grows.

Specific responsibilities include:-
Supplier Relationship & Stakeholder Management and Strategic understanding
-
Be a member of and possible management of the subordinate teams overseeing the management of supplier cost, schedule and technical performance on moderate-to-high-risk, modified Commercial Off The Shelf, performance specification and complex build-to-print subcontracts for commercial, MOD and international programs.
-
Part of multifunctional subcontract management teams, comprising quality, engineering and other supply chain team members.
-
Holding a procurement delegation and signing supplier agreements and purchase orders within this.
-
Developing subcontract specifications, work statements, and terms and conditions for the procurement of specialised materials, equipment, and services for subcontract systems in support of development, production and sustainment using multiple contract types.
-
Selecting or recommending subcontractors, and writing subcontract packages.
-
Preparing, awarding and managing resulting subcontracts and required change activity.
